Nationalism in India
Impact of World War One on India
The war had a significant impact on India's economy and
society.
Indian soldiers fought in the war, and many died.
The war led to a rise in nationalist sentiments among Indians.
Gandhiji's Satyagraha Struggle
Mahatma Gandhi was a prominent leader of the Indian
nationalist movement.
His satyagraha struggle was a form of nonviolent resistance
against British rule.
Non-Cooperation Movement
The Non-Cooperation Movement was a mass civil
disobedience movement launched by the Indian National
Congress in 1920.
The movement aimed to reject British rule and promote the
use of Swadeshi (indigenous) goods.
Rich Peasants and Land Revenue
Rich peasants in India were often involved in the nationalist
movement.
They opposed the British government's policies regarding
land revenue and demanded fair treatment.
